FIN EC 2023 for Structural Engineers – Structural Analysis

FIN EC 2023 is a structural analysis software designed for engineering design tasks. This tool is utilized within the civil engineering and structural engineering fields, particularly for projects involving the analysis of concrete and steel frameworks. It is intended for structural engineers who require detailed evaluations of structural elements and their performance under various conditions. A key capability is its application of finite element analysis (FEA) to assess deformations and internal forces.

Core Structural Design Capabilities

The software provides functionalities for both 2D and 3D finite element analysis, referred to as Fin 2D and Fin 3D respectively. These capabilities allow engineers to model and analyze deformations and internal forces within structural components. The structural design functions are geared towards fulfilling the complex requirements of modern engineering projects, ensuring accurate assessments of structural behavior under load.

Special Features for Reinforcement and Load Analysis

FIN EC 2023 incorporates specialized features that enhance its utility in detailed structural design. Notably, it offers advanced options for analyzing shear reinforcement, with a specific focus on punching shear reinforcement in concrete structures. Additionally, the software provides enhanced loading summaries, which aggregate and present load data clearly for comprehensive analysis and review by structural engineers.

Real-World Applications and Use Cases

Structural engineers leverage FIN EC 2023 in projects demanding precise structural analysis. For instance, it can be applied in the design and assessment of building foundations, identifying crucial areas needing specific shear reinforcement to prevent failure modes like punching shear. The software’s detailed output for deformations and internal forces is also valuable in bridge engineering for analyzing load distributions and structural stability.
